- Cyberabad authorities took three suspects into custody on September 22 in connection with the September 14 assault and killing under Kismatpur bridge.
- The accused were identified as Gulam Dastagir, 26, Mohd Imran, 25, and Meka Durga Reddy, 33, all residents of Hyderabad neighborhoods.
- Police say Reddy first lured the intoxicated woman on September 14, bought liquor and food, sexually assaulted her at Satamrai in Shamshabad, then left her at Aramgarh crossroads.
- Investigators allege Dastagir and Imran later forced her into an auto‑rickshaw, drove to the bridge, gang raped her, and one assailant fatally beat her with a stick; locals noticed the body near bushes on September 16.
- Rajendranagar police and the Cyberabad Special Operations Team traced the auto‑rickshaw through CCTV, registered a case under relevant BNS provisions, remanded the trio, and continue the probe.
